## Runbook: Fan-out backpressure rollout

Reviewer notes for the Herald notification service. This release introduces bounded queues between the fan-out stage and the push workers; when depth exceeds the watermark, Herald sheds low-priority digests rather than blocking ingestion. Please confirm the shed counter is wired to the Spindle dashboard and that retry jitter is applied before requeue. The deploy artifact must be verified before promotion to the Tarnwick cluster. Check the signature against the key below.

release key, fajef-kajeg: bky19_LdLu6Ne6FLi8he2c24d

WIKI (Managers Only) — Bramfield Depot Lease

Status: renegotiation active. Landlord, Quillane Properties, offered a five-year term at 7% above current rate; we countered at 2% with a break clause at year three. Facilities says relocation costs exceed any plausible premium. Incoming director signs the final terms. The underlying rationale appears below.

confidential, kagup-bafog: Fraaxax Group is in early talks to buy Soroxox Group for about $343.8 million. The Olidor launch date is June 14, and nothing goes to the press before then. Legal wants the Aldmirek Logistics term sheet signed before July 23.

### Digest Scheduling — Mailspool

Batch email digests are scheduled by the Mailspool cron service, which reads recipient batches from the queue table every fifteen minutes. When reviewing changes to the scheduler, confirm that batch size stays under 500 and that the idempotency token is preserved across retries, or duplicate digests will go out. To run the scheduler locally against the staging queue, authenticate with the service key provided below.

API key for yafof-bagef: vxb7-jBBsZhX

# Environment Variables — Quillstack Assignment Service

For this week's sync: the Quillstack A/B assignment service reads its config entirely from env at boot; there is no hot reload. EXP_BUCKET_COUNT and EXP_HASH_SALT must match across all replicas or users flip cohorts mid-session. ASSIGN_CACHE_TTL defaults to 300 seconds and rarely needs changing. Staging and production use separate salts by design. The final required variable is the credential the service uses to write assignments to the Corvid store, which appears directly below.

env line for yahip-tafog: RELAY_SECRET3=4ca